Constructing a Career: Home Builders Institute Turns Soldiers Into Skilled Trades Workers

With more than 278,000 job openings in the construction industry in 2018, a critical need for new workers must be addressed. Home Builders Institute, which has a long history of training construction workers, is pioneering a new approach to creating a strong workforce pipeline. The nonprofit organization is providing free skills training for transitioning servicemen and women on military bases and helping them secure jobs after discharge. Thanks to continued funding from The Home Depot Foundation, HBI will expand its Department of Labor-recognized program to more military installations over the next decade. Local Talent – Not For Export: Delta College Fast Start™ Training Programs | WorkingNation

The Delta College Fast Start™ training program with the Dow Chemical Company and Great Lakes Bay Michigan Works ensures that the largest employer in this Michigan region has a skilled workforce comprised of homegrown talent. In just 13 weeks, Fast Start™ participants Spencer and Trevor received hands-on training from retired Dow workers, gaining skills that put them above and beyond other job seekers.
